Hello everyone, I am considering how to convert my Ikea PAX wardrobe into a shoe cabinet and use it as efficiently as possible. Specifically, I want to design the interior layout to maximize storage space for shoes of different sizes and types, while still maintaining a clear overview and avoiding overly cramped shoes. Additionally, I would like to know which shelves, baskets, or special inserts work best to separate and neatly store sneakers, boots, and formal shoes. Does anyone have experience with custom modifications or tips on how to modularly convert the PAX so that it functions well as a shoe cabinet? I am looking for practical ideas that are easy to implement and do not require too much DIY work.

Hi! I would simply use lower shelves and space the shelf boards closer together. For boots, usually reserve a separate compartment with more height. Add a few drawers at the bottom for smaller shoes or accessories. This way, you make good use of the space.

I am really excited about the idea of converting PAX! 😍 I have stored my sneakers in shallow drawers, so I can see them quickly. A tip: The small boxes from Ikea, which are actually meant for drawers, work perfectly as compartments! This way, nothing slides around. And adding some LED lighting makes a huge difference and greatly improves visibility.
